Hemis National Park:
Hemis, the largest national park in South Asia, is a sanctuary for the elusive and majestic snow leopard. Spread over 4,400 square kilometers, this park is a haven for wildlife en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. The park is not only home to the elusive snow leopard but also houses various other endangered species such as the Himalayan blue sheep, ibex, and red fox. The Hemis Monastery, located within the park, adds a cultural touch to the natural beauty, making it a holistic experience. Aharbal Falls:
Aharbal Falls is known as the "Niagara of Kashmir" due to the force with which water pours from above into a pool below, making an unforgettable spectacle. Trekking trails leading up to Aharbal offer adventure seekers and scenic admirers alike an unmissable treat in Kashmir's waterfall country.
